A 1 1/2-inch diameter standard galvanized steel pipe railing stands at a total height of 3 feet 6 inches above the structural framing. A galvanized steel kickplate is positioned at the base of the railing adjacent to a galvanized metal grating. The grating bears on a steel angle connected to a structural steel beam, with reference made to structural sheet S-170 for framing details.
